“Isn’t That Special?”

The Church Lady was a Saturday Night Live character, and with all such characterizations there is a grain of truth at its core. And she came to mind as I was just viewing a post on Medium.com with the title “Like Israel of Old, Is The United States God’s Favored Nation?” While people debate this … Continue reading “Isn’t That Special?”